For those unfamiliar, Thread is a low-power, low-latency networking technology specifically designed for use in smart home devices. It allows devices to communicate with each other and with the cloud, making it an essential component in the creation of seamless smart home experiences. The Thread network operates on a mesh topology, which means that devices can communicate with each other directly, reducing the reliance on a central hub or router.
The Limitations of Border Routers
Traditionally, setting up a Thread network required the use of a border router, which acts as a gateway between the Thread network and the wider internet. This device is usually a dedicated router that sits between the Thread network and the user’s Wi-Fi network. While border routers have been instrumental in facilitating communication between devices, they can be a barrier to entry for those new to smart home technology.
The need for a border router can be a significant hurdle, particularly for those who are still in the early stages of building their smart home ecosystem. Not only do these devices add to the overall cost of the system, but they can also be a source of complexity, requiring users to configure and manage multiple devices.
